媒体数据库的设计与继承
媒体数据库的设计
CD资料库
首先需要一个容器,自己设计一个类,由这个类来表达一个CD,把这个CD放在容器里面,从而形成一个资料库
代码中的问题:代码复制,后期不容易改进,如果再添加一个mp4,就又需要添加修改一堆东西,也不利于后期改进
继承
继承的关键字:extends
利用继承的关系,CD和DVD类继承了Item,CD和DVD就成了子类,子类会继承父类的所有东西,所以直接调用Item就可以实现CD和DVD里面的数据信息